   reply to: [[Redirection] Regex that states only match /x… but not /y/x…](https://wordpress.org/support/topic/regex-that-states-only-match-x-but-not-y-x/)
 *  Thread Starter [Nethers Web Design](https://wordpress.org/support/users/timnethersgmailcom/)
 * (@timnethersgmailcom)
 * [7 years, 5 months ago](https://wordpress.org/support/topic/regex-that-states-only-match-x-but-not-y-x/#post-10926672)
 * Solved in the stack overflow:
    ^(?!.*/y/x).+x.*
 * Where y is about

   reply to: [[Formstack Online Forms] jQuery Conflict w/ Slider Revolution](https://wordpress.org/support/topic/jquery-conflict-w-slider-revolution/)
 *  Thread Starter [Nethers Web Design](https://wordpress.org/support/users/timnethersgmailcom/)
 * (@timnethersgmailcom)
 * [7 years, 11 months ago](https://wordpress.org/support/topic/jquery-conflict-w-slider-revolution/#post-10314682)
 * Thanks Michael, I blindly copied and pasted the code from another page and forgot
   to check the TinyMCE area. Doh.
 *   Forum: [Plugins](https://wordpress.org/support/forum/plugins-and-hacks/)
    In
   reply to: [[Formstack Online Forms] jQuery Conflict w/ Slider Revolution](https://wordpress.org/support/topic/jquery-conflict-w-slider-revolution/)
 *  Thread Starter [Nethers Web Design](https://wordpress.org/support/users/timnethersgmailcom/)
 * (@timnethersgmailcom)
 * [7 years, 11 months ago](https://wordpress.org/support/topic/jquery-conflict-w-slider-revolution/#post-10314581)
 * Slider Revolution requires a strict version of jQuery, thus it calls jQuery on
   its own. Additionally, the Formstack Plugin uses the basic formstack embed which
   also includes a different version of jQuery.
 * For some reason, the formstack version being called trumps the slider revolution
   version and causes Slider Revolution to not load due to its strict requirement
   of the other version of jQuery. The workaround is a manual formstack form embed
   copied from the Publishing tab with the Advanced Options box unchecked for ‘I
   don’t need jQuery’. Thus, it pulls the jQuery from the existing Slide Revolution
   call.
